3. There are four teams in the raquetball league on the island of Allendine. In a season, they play each other once. Three point

s are awarded for a win, one for a draw and none for a loss. At the end of the season, the points were as follows:
Arcadia 4

Brextone 4

Cremore 2

Dunross 6


a) How many matches were drawn?


b) What was the result of the match between Dunross and Cremore?


c) If Brextone beat Dunross, can you determine the results of all the matches?

Answer:

a) 2 matches dawn

b) Dunross won that game

c) Yes we can determine the results of all matches ( see step by step explanation)

Step-by-step explanation:

Let call Acadia team ( team A ) Brextone team ( team B ) Cremore team ( team C) and Dunross team (team D)

As each team play each other once, the the games were:

A     plays    vs   B     C     and    D

B     plays     vs          C     and    D

C     plays     vs                            D

A won    one match   and draw  other and lost the other   so made 4 points

B  did the same   4 points

C  got drawn in  two games and lost the third   total of  2 points

D won 2 games and lost  2       total    of  6 points

a) A had one match  drawn

   B had one match  drawn

   C had  two match drawn

Then we have a total of two matches drawn

b) Dunross won that game

c) If B  beat  D   we can determine the others results

as follows

C  lost the game with  D  and drawn with  A  and  B

D  won game with C , lost the game with B and won the game with A

A  lost the game with D , drawn a game with C and won the game with B

B  Lost the game with A , drawn the game with C and, won the game with D
